Why it matters

A checklist run once by whoever remembers to run it isn't a process, it's a habit that depends on one person. A real SOP survives someone leaving the team, a tight deadline, or a course being edited six months after it first shipped. Without one, accessibility testing quietly stops being reliable exactly when it matters most, under time pressure.

When you'll encounter this

  • You're setting up how a team, not just yourself, handles accessibility testing.
  • Testing currently depends on one person remembering to do it.
  • A course that passed review once was edited later and nobody re-tested it.
  • A stakeholder or client asks how your team verifies accessibility, and there's no clear answer beyond "we check it."

Best practices

  • Assign accessibility testing responsibility to a role, not a specific person, so the process survives staff changes. It doesn't have to be a full-time job, it has to be someone's clearly stated job.
  • Combine three methods, not one: an automated scan (fast, consistent, catches structural issues at scale), a manual keyboard-only pass (catches what a scan can't judge, like whether tab order actually makes sense), and a periodic real screen reader read-through (catches what neither of the other two can).
  • Test at three points, not one: once when a course is built, again right before publishing (content can drift during review), and again after any substantive edit post-launch.
  • Record what was tested, how, and by whom, even a simple shared log is enough. The goal is being able to answer "was this tested?" with evidence, not memory.
  • Review the SOP itself periodically, a process that made sense for one course a year ago might not fit a different kind of course today.

Common mistakes

  • Relying on a single method, usually just an automated scan, and treating a clean result as a complete accessibility review.
  • Testing once at launch and never again, even after later edits change what's actually published.
  • Making accessibility testing one specific person's informal responsibility instead of a defined role, so it quietly stops happening when that person is busy or leaves.
  • Having no record of testing having happened, so a compliance question later has no evidence to point to.

Practical checklist

  • A specific role, not just a person, is responsible for accessibility testing.
  • Automated scanning, manual keyboard testing, and periodic screen reader testing are all part of the process, not just one of the three.
  • Testing happens at build, pre-publish, and after any substantive post-launch edit, not just once.
  • Testing activity is logged somewhere the team can point to later.
  • The SOP itself is reviewed periodically, not treated as permanently finished.

Frequently asked questions

Isn't a checklist enough?

A checklist tells you what to look for on one course, once. An SOP is what makes sure that checklist actually gets run, by someone, every time, for every course, not just when someone happens to remember.

Who should own this on a small team with no dedicated accessibility specialist?

Someone still needs the role, even part-time, even as one responsibility among several. The risk isn't having a small team, it's having no one clearly responsible, see Who Should Own Accessibility Testing on a Team for a deeper look at this specific question.

How much of this can be automated?

The scanning step, fully. The keyboard and screen reader steps still need a person; automation makes those faster to prioritize (a scan tells you where to focus a manual pass) but doesn't replace them, see A11yCheck's Review Methodology for exactly where that line sits.

Summary

A checklist tells you what to check once. An SOP is what makes accessibility testing happen reliably, every course, every time, regardless of who's on the team or how tight the deadline is: a defined role, three combined testing methods, three points in the course lifecycle, and a real record that it happened.
